2강. 통신 제어 기술
추천글 : 【정보통신망 기술】 정보통신망 기술 목차
1. 통신 제어의 기본 [본문]
2. 신호 변환 - 디지털 변조 [본문]
3. 신호 변환 - 펄스 변조 [본문]
4. 신호 변환 - 베이스밴드 전송 [본문]
5. 데이터 링크 제어 프로토콜 - BSC [본문]
6. 데이터 링크 제어 프로토콜 - HDLC [본문]
7. 오류 제어 방식 [본문]
8. 오류 검출 방식 [본문]
1. 통신 제어의 기본 [목차]
⑴ 통신 속도와 통신 용량
⑵ 전송 방식 : 아날로그/디지털 전송, 직렬/병렬 전송, 동기식/비동기식 전송
⑶ 통신 방식
① 단방향(Simplex) 통신 : 한쪽 방향으로만 전송 가능
○ 예 : 라디오, TV
② 반이중(Half-Duplex) 통신 : 양방향 전송이 가능하나 동시에는 불가능, 2선식 회선
○ 예 : 무전기
③ 전이중(Full-Duplex) 통신 : 동시에 양방향 전송이 가능, 4선식 회선(2선식도 가능)
○ 예 : 전화
⑷ 회선 구성 방식
① Point-to-Point : 중앙 컴퓨터와 단말기를 1 : 1로 독립적으로 연결하는 방식
② Multi-Point(Multi-Drop) : 여러 대의 단말기들을 한 개의 통신 회선에 연결, 중앙 컴퓨터가 주국이 됨
③ 회선 다중 방식 : 여러 대의 단말기들을 다중화 장치를 이용하여 중앙 컴퓨터와 연결
⑸ 회선 제어 방식 : 여러 대의 단말장치가 동시에 데이터를 보내지 못하도록 하는 기술
① 경쟁 방식 : 송신 요구를 먼저 한 쪽이 송신 권한을 가지는 방식, Point-to-Point 방식에서 사용
② Polling/Selection 방식 : 주 컴퓨터에서 송·수신 제어권을 가지는 방식, Multi-Point 방식에서 사용
○ Polling : 주 컴퓨터가 단말기에게 전송을 허가하는 방식
○ Selection : 주 컴퓨터가 단말기에게 수신이 준비됐는지 묻고, 준비됐으면 보내는 방식
2. 신호 변환 - 디지털 변조 [목차]
3. 신호 변환 - 펄스 변조 [목차]
4. 신호 변환 - 베이스밴드 전송 [목차]
5. 데이터 링크 제어 프로토콜 - BSC(Binary Synchronous Control) [목차]
⑴ BSC : 문자 위주 방식
① 반이중 전송, Stop-and-Wait ARQ를 사용
② 오류 검출이 어렵고, 전송 효율이 나쁨
⑵ 프레임 구조 = 헤더(SYN - SYN - SOH - Heading - STX) + 텍스트(본문) + 트레일러(ETX/ETB - BCC)
① SYN : 송·수신측 간 동기화를 위해 사용하는 문자로, 데이터와 구분하기 위해 각 프레임 내 두 개 이상
② Heading : 데이터 프레임 순서, 수신 스테이션 주소 등
③ BCC(Block Check Character) : 전송된 프레임의 오류 검출 문자
④ 기타 전송 제어문자
○ SOH(Start of Heading)
○ STX(Start of Text)
○ ETX(End of Text)
○ ETB(End of Transmission Block)
○ EOT(End of Transmission)
○ ENQ(Enquiry)
○ DLE(Data Link Escape) : 전송 제어문자 앞
○ ACK
○ NAK
6. 데이터 링크 제어 프로토콜 - HDLC [목차]
⑴ SDLC : BSC와 HDLC의 중간 단계, HDLC와 동일한 프레임 구조
⑵ HDLC : 비트 위주의 프로토콜
⑶ 프레임 구조 = 헤더(플래그 - 주소부 - 제어부) + 텍스트(정보부) + 트레일러(FCS - 플래그)
① 플래그(Flag) : 프레임의 시작과 끝을 표시. '01111110'
② 주소부 : 송·수신국 식별 목적. 방송용은 '11111111'. 시험용은 '00000000'
③ 제어부 : 프레임의 종류 식별
○ I 프레임 : 정보 프레임, '0'으로 시작, 사용자 데이터 전달
○ S 프레임 : 감독 프레임, '10'으로 시작, 오류 제어와 흐름 제어
○ U 프레임 : 비번호 프레임, '11'로 시작, 링크의 동작 모드 설정과 관리
④ FCS(Frame Check Sequence Field) : 오류 검출 코드(주로 CRC 코드), 16-32 bit
7. 오류 제어 방식 [목차]
⑴ 순방향 오류 수정(FEC, Forward Error Correction) : 검출된 오류를 수신 측에서 수정하는 방식
⑵ 역방향 오류 수정(BEC, Backward Error Correction) : 오류가 검출되면 송신 측에 재전송을 요구하는 방식
① 자동 반복 요청(ARQ, Automatic Repeat Request) : 수신 측이 송신 측에게 통보하고, 재전송하는 절차
② Stop-and-Wait ARQ : 송신 측에서 한 개의 블록을 전송한 후 수신 측으로부터 응답을 기다리는 방식
③ Go-Back-N ARQ : 수신 측에서 NAK를 보내면 오류가 발생한 블록 이후의 모든 블록을 재전송하는 방식
④ 선택적 재전송 ARQ : 수신 측에서 NAK를 보내면 오류가 발생한 블록만 재전송하는 방식
⑤ 적응적 ARQ : 데이터 블록의 길이를 채널의 상태에 따라 동적으로 변경하는 방식
8. 오류 검출 방식 [목차]
⑴ 패리티 검사(Parity Check)
⑵ 순환 중복 검사(CRC)
⑶ 에코 검사(Echo Check)
⑷ 자동 연속 방식
⑸ 해밍 코드(Hamming Code)
⑹ 상승 코드 방식
입력: 2017.07.19 18:31
'▶ 자연과학 > ▷ 정보통신망 기술' 카테고리의 다른 글
【정보통신망 기술】 4-2강. TCP 헤더의 구성 (0) | 2017.08.06 |
---|---|
【정보통신망 기술】 4-1강. IP 헤더의 구성 (0) | 2017.08.06 |
【정보통신망 기술】 4강. 정보 통신망 (0) | 2017.07.16 |
【정보통신망 기술】 3강. 통신 프로토콜 (1) | 2017.07.16 |
【정보통신망 기술】 1강. 통신시스템의 구성 (0) | 2017.07.16 |
최근댓글